Poli Huduga (transl. Rogue boy) is a 1989 Kannada-language action drama film written by Paruchuri Brothers and directed by S. S. Ravichandra. The film cast includes V. Ravichandran, Karishma, Tara and Devaraj, while many other prominent actors featured in supporting roles.[1] The soundtrack and score composition was by Hamsalekha. The film was a remake of Telugu film Kaliyuga Pandavulu.

The music was composed and lyrics written by Hamsalekha and audio was bought by Lahari Music.[2]
